#c33310 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#c33310 is composed of 76.5% red, 20%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 73.8% magenta, 91.8% yellow and 23.5% black. It has a hue angle of 11.7 degrees, a saturation of 84.8% and a lightness of 41.4%. #c33310 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ff6620 with #870000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

#c33310 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#c33310 has RGB values of R:195, G:51, B:16 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.74, Y:0.92, K:0.24. Its decimal value is 12792592.

Shades and Tints of #c33310
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0401 is the darkest color, while #fffbf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#c33310
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6a6969 is the less saturated color, while #cb2e08 is the most saturated one.
